Head Coach Jeremy Provence

  • Five of his runners have been named American Southwest Conference Cross Country Runners of the Week
  • Has had 20 runners on the American Southwest Conference Cross Country All-Academic Team
  • Coached the American Southwest Conference Cross Country Sportsmanship Male Athlete of the Year
  • His women's cross country program was awarded the United States Track and Field and Cross Country Coaches Association Women's Team Academic Award (2016)
  • Seven of his runners have competed in the NCAA III Regional cross country race
  • Led the women's and men's track program to the school's first American Southwest Conference Championship appearance
  • Three of his track athletes achieved ASC All-Academic Team honors (2017)
  • Coached the winner of the American Southwest Conference Women's Track Sportsmanship Athlete of the Year (2017)
  • Adjunct instructor for the Health Science program at University of the Ozarks

Jonathon Wood

  • 2016: Was the team's top finisher in each race. Named ASC Runner of the Week once. Ran a 31:45.96 to place 133rd overall at the 8K Rhodes College Invitational. At the 8K Chile Pepper Festival, ran a 30:18.62 for 265th place. Placed 36th overall at the U of O Invitational running a 29:28.3. Ran a 26:17.8 in the 4.1-mile Arkansas Division III Championships to finish fifth overall. Ran a 30.02.5 for 32nd place at the ASC Championships. Posted a time of 29:59.84 at the 8K NCAA III Regional to finish 168th.

NCAA Division III

The college experience is a time of learning and growth — a chance to follow passions and develop potential. For student-athletes in Division III, all of this happens most importantly in the classroom and through earning an academic degree. The Division III experience provides for passionate participation in a competitive athletic environment, in which student-athletes push themselves to excellence and build upon their academic success with new challenges and life skills. And student-athletes are encouraged to pursue their full passions and find their potential through a comprehensive educational experience.
